BBB Foods Inc. - Asset Resilience Ratio
BBB Foods Inc. (TBBB) has an Asset Resilience Ratio of 10.23% as of September 2025. The Asset Resilience Ratio measures the percentage of a company's total assets that are held in liquid form (cash and short-term investments). This metric indicates how well-positioned the company is to handle unexpected financial challenges, economic downturns, or strategic opportunities without requiring external financing. About BBB Foods Inc.
BBB Foods Inc., through its subsidiaries, operates a chain of grocery retail stores in Mexico. The company offers spot products comprising food and non-food products, such as clothing, electronics, household goods, and others. It also provides branded and private label products.
